Taxonomic Classification

Rank Lumholtz's tree kangaroo Phayre's leaf monkey
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class same Mammalia (Mammals)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Diprotodontia (Marsupials) Primates (Primates)
Family Macropodidae (Kangaroos) Cercopithecidae (Old World Monkeys)
Genus Dendrolagus Trachypithecus
Species Dendrolagus lumholtzi Trachypithecus phayrei

Evolutionary Relationship

Lumholtz's tree kangaroo and Phayre's leaf monkey share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
